Solitaire: Klondike is a timeless card game that has captivated players for generations. Its origins trace back to the 19th century, and it serves as a brilliant blend of strategy, patience, and luck. The game is typically played using a standard deck of playing cards, where the primary objective is to arrange all cards into four foundation piles, sorted by suit and in ascending order. As players navigate through the tableau, they must employ clever tactics to uncover hidden cards, while also managing their limited moves wisely.

Playing Solitaire: Klondike is straightforward. Start by dealing cards into seven tableau columns, where only the top card is visible. The goal is to move cards to the foundation piles, arranged by suit from Ace to King. You can move cards between tableau columns, and you can draw from the stockpile to uncover additional cards. Keep an eye on card placements and use strategies to uncover hidden cards while maintaining focus on your overall objective!
